Ros*_*ine 5 javascript selenium angularjs selenium-webdriver protractor
我们使用Protractor来测试Angular JS项目.在填写所有必填字段后,我需要在空白处(任何空白处)点击一个页面以触发自动保存.
但我不知道怎么做.我试图找到一个无用的图像或点击文本框.它不能工作.
堆栈跟踪:
UnknownError:未知错误:元素在点(975,357)处无法点击.其他元素将收到点击:...*
任何评论都会有所帮助,非常感谢.
一种选择是找到一个特定元素并单击一个偏移量:
var elm = element(by.css('.material-dialog-container'));
browser.actions()
.mouseMove(elm, -20, -20)
.click()
.perform();
Run Code Online (Sandbox Code Playgroud)
偏移量从元素的左上角开始计算.
| 归档时间: |
|
| 查看次数: |
1645 次 |
| 最近记录: |